The Director level, In-Business Risk (IBR) Structurer will report to the Global Head of Prime Finance In-Business Risk (IBR) and will be responsible for counterparty and platform risk management of Citi's cash and synthetic Prime Brokerage and Equity Delta One Business lines. This individual will be:
  • Solutions-oriented client engagement through-out the lifecycle of a client
  • First line of defense in risk managing credit risk and monitoring platform exposure
  • Understanding market and credit risks within Prime products and effectively communicating to senior management and control functions
  • Evolving the risk framework and other risk governance items to ensure a proper control environment and strategic platform development
  • Serve as Prime Finance product SME and business representative for regional Regulatory inquiries and periodic requests
  • Key in-business escalation point for emerging counterparty risk events and crisis management.


Job Background / Context:
  • Global platform includes Prime Brokerage and Swap offerings across US and international broker dealer and bank chain entities
  • Client portfolios comprise of a broad range of asset classes and investment strategies. Typical product scope includes:
    • Asset classes: equities (incl ETFs, custom baskets, OTC); fixed income corporates and converts; listed options
    • Strategies: Equity Long/Short; Quant; Multi-Strat; Event; Macro; Credit opportunity; etc.
    • Hedge Fund and Real Money counterparties.

About Citigroup, Inc

Citigroup is a financial services holding company that provides financial products and services. The company operates through two segments, Global Consumer Banking (GCB) and Institutional Clients Group (ICG). The GCB segment offers traditional banking services to retail customers through retail banking, commercial banking, Citi-branded cards, and Citi retail services. The ICG segment offers various banking, and financial products and services to corporate, institutional, public sector, and high-net-worth clients. This segment provides wholesale banking products and services, including fixed-income and equity sales and trading, foreign exchange, prime brokerage, derivative services, equity and fixed-income research, corporate lending, investment banking, and advisory services, private banking, cash management, trade finance, and securities services.
